Product Icon

EU VAT Number for WooCommerce

Collect VAT numbers at checkout and remove the VAT charge for eligible EU businesses.
Choose a billing option
$39
Save 20%
$78 $62.40

Subscription includes

  • Product updates and improvements
  • Customer support
  • 30-day money-back guarantee

  • Collect and validate EU Value Added Tax (VAT) numbers at checkout.
  • Exempt businesses from paying VAT, if necessary.
  • Collect and validate user location in business-to-consumer (B2C) transactions.
  • Handle EU tax requirements for digital goods.

This extension provides your checkout with a field to collect and validate a customer’s EU VAT number if they have one. Upon entering a valid VAT number, the business will not be charged VAT in your store.

EU VAT Number field with focus showing the label above and description below, both editable in the settings.

Documentation

Need guidance? Check out the comprehensive documentation to learn everything about you need to know about the EU VAT Number extension.

View documentation.


Questions and support

If you have pre-sale questions or need help, get in touch with our friendly Happiness Engineers.

Get support.


Frequently asked questions

How does the VAT number validation work?

The validation function uses the VIES VAT number validation API from the European Commission.

Will customers outside Europe see this field?

Customers located outside the EU will not see any VAT fields as they are out of scope for EU VAT.

How do I set up EU VAT rates for digital goods?

For EU VAT on digital goods, you need to input VAT rates into WooCommerce. See how to set up EU VAT rates for digital products.

Customer reviews

Extension information

  • PHP version required: 7.4
  • Tested with WordPress: 6.7
  • Tested with WooCommerce: 9.6

Compatibility

  • Cart & checkout blocks
  • High performance order storage (HPOS)

Countries

  • Worldwide

Requirements

  • WooCommerce version 9.4 or higher
  • WordPress version 6.7 or higher
  • PHP version 7.2 or higher